class StorageProvider(object):
 | 
						|
    """A storage provider is a service that can store uploaded media and
 | 
						|
    retrieve them.
 | 
						|
    """
 | 
						|
    def store_file(self, path, file_info):
 | 
						|
        """Store the file described by file_info. The actual contents can be
 | 
						|
        retrieved by reading the file in file_info.upload_path.
 | 
						|
 | 
						|
        Args:
 | 
						|
            path (str): Relative path of file in local cache
 | 
						|
            file_info (FileInfo)
 | 
						|
 | 
						|
        Returns:
 | 
						|
            Deferred
 | 
						|
        """
 | 
						|
        pass
 | 
						|
 | 
						|
    def fetch(self, path, file_info):
 | 
						|
        """Attempt to fetch the file described by file_info and stream it
 | 
						|
        into writer.
 | 
						|
 | 
						|
        Args:
 | 
						|
            path (str): Relative path of file in local cache
 | 
						|
            file_info (FileInfo)
 | 
						|
 | 
						|
        Returns:
 | 
						|
            Deferred(Responder): Returns a Responder if the provider has the file,
 | 
						|
                otherwise returns None.
 | 
						|
        """
 | 
						|
        pass
 | 
						|
 | 
						|
 | 
						|
class StorageProviderWrapper(StorageProvider):
 | 
						|
    """Wraps a storage provider and provides various config options
 | 
						|
 | 
						|
    Args:
 | 
						|
        backend (StorageProvider)
 | 
						|
        store_local (bool): Whether to store new local files or not.
 | 
						|
        store_synchronous (bool): Whether to wait for file to be successfully
 | 
						|
            uploaded, or todo the upload in the backgroud.
 | 
						|
        store_remote (bool): Whether remote media should be uploaded
 | 
						|
    """
 | 
						|
    def __init__(self, backend, store_local, store_synchronous, store_remote):
 | 
						|
        self.backend = backend
 | 
						|
        self.store_local = store_local
 | 
						|
        self.store_synchronous = store_synchronous
 | 
						|
        self.store_remote = store_remote
 | 
						|
 | 
						|
    def store_file(self, path, file_info):
 | 
						|
        if not file_info.server_name and not self.store_local:
 | 
						|
            return defer.succeed(None)
 | 
						|
 | 
						|
        if file_info.server_name and not self.store_remote:
 | 
						|
            return defer.succeed(None)
 | 
						|
 | 
						|
        if self.store_synchronous:
 | 
						|
            return self.backend.store_file(path, file_info)
 | 
						|
        else:
 | 
						|
            # TODO: Handle errors.
 | 
						|
            def store():
 | 
						|
                try:
 | 
						|
                    return self.backend.store_file(path, file_info)
 | 
						|
                except Exception:
 | 
						|
                    logger.exception("Error storing file")
 | 
						|
            run_in_background(store)
 | 
						|
            return defer.succeed(None)
 | 
						|
 | 
						|
    def fetch(self, path, file_info):
 | 
						|
        return self.backend.fetch(path, file_info)

class FileStorageProviderBackend(StorageProvider):
 | 
						|
    """A storage provider that stores files in a directory on a filesystem.
 | 
						|
 | 
						|
    Args:
 | 
						|
        hs (HomeServer)
 | 
						|
        config: The config returned by `parse_config`.
 | 
						|
    """
 | 
						|
 | 
						|
    def __init__(self, hs, config):
 | 
						|
        self.cache_directory = hs.config.media_store_path
 | 
						|
        self.base_directory = config
 | 
						|
 | 
						|
    def store_file(self, path, file_info):
 | 
						|
        """See StorageProvider.store_file"""
 | 
						|
 | 
						|
        primary_fname = os.path.join(self.cache_directory, path)
 | 
						|
        backup_fname = os.path.join(self.base_directory, path)
 | 
						|
 | 
						|
        dirname = os.path.dirname(backup_fname)
 | 
						|
        if not os.path.exists(dirname):
 | 
						|
            os.makedirs(dirname)
 | 
						|
 | 
						|
        return logcontext.defer_to_thread(
 | 
						|
            self.hs.get_reactor(),
 | 
						|
            shutil.copyfile, primary_fname, backup_fname,
 | 
						|
        )
 | 
						|
 | 
						|
    def fetch(self, path, file_info):
 | 
						|
        """See StorageProvider.fetch"""
 | 
						|
 | 
						|
        backup_fname = os.path.join(self.base_directory, path)
 | 
						|
        if os.path.isfile(backup_fname):
 | 
						|
            return FileResponder(open(backup_fname, "rb"))
 | 
						|
 | 
						|
    @staticmethod
 | 
						|
    def parse_config(config):
 | 
						|
        """Called on startup to parse config supplied. This should parse
 | 
						|
        the config and raise if there is a problem.
 | 
						|
 | 
						|
        The returned value is passed into the constructor.
 | 
						|
 | 
						|
        In this case we only care about a single param, the directory, so let's
 | 
						|
        just pull that out.
 | 
						|
        """
 | 
						|
        return Config.ensure_directory(config["directory"])
